This week...
in phonics Reception children have been learning about ur and ir as alternatives for the er digraph e. surf and girl. We have talked about er normally coming at the end of a word. The Year ones have been learning ph as f e.g. ph e.g. phonics.
We are hearing all the children read this week as normal.
In Talk Through Stories it is our vocabulary week from Six Dinner Sid and the words are discovered, slip out, unlike, tough, damp, suspicious, believed and furious. We have heard some good uses of these words this week already.
This week is assessment week so we are not doing story scribes this week as all the children have written a sentence without any help so we can see what they can do independently. We are really pleased to see how much the children have progressed with their writing.
We are also assessing maths but we are still doing some mastering number work. We looking at how 7 is made up and all the different parts that can make 7.
We also had our very exciting trip out on Wednesday to Avian Dance which the children all thoroughly enjoyed and we hope you have heard lots about the day. They took part in street dance, acro, gymnastics and baton twirling. There will be a news story going on the website with some photos soon so keep an eye out for that!
